Jablonica railway station
Jablonica railway station is a railway station in Jablonica, Senica District, Trnava Region. Jablonica railway station is situated nearby to the community center Kultúrny dom, as well as near the peak Rákociho vŕšok.Photo: Akul59, CC BY-SA 4.0.

Osuské
Village
Photo: Ľuboš Repta,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Osuské is a village and municipality in Senica District in the Trnava Region of western Slovakia. There is a Catholic church first mentioned in 1468 with an organ rebuilt in 1844. Osuské is situated 3 km northeast of Jablonica railway station.
Cerová
Village
Photo: Lure,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Cerová is a village and municipality in Senica District in the Trnava Region of western Slovakia. The village is divided into three parts: Cerová, Lieskové, and Rozbehy. Cerová is situated 3 km southwest of Jablonica railway station.
